Understanding Your Internet Needs in Crawley, Virginias
Before diving into the list of internet providers, it's crucial to assess your internet needs. Consider the following factors:
Usage: How many devices will be connected to the internet simultaneously? What activities will you be primarily using the internet for (e.g., streaming, gaming, video conferencing, browsing)?
Speed: What internet speed do you require for your activities? For basic browsing and email, lower speeds might suffice, while streaming and gaming require higher speeds.
Budget: How much are you willing to spend on internet service each month?
Contract Length: Are you comfortable with a long-term contract, or do you prefer a month-to-month option?

2. How much internet speed do I need in Crawley, Virginias?
The required internet speed depends on your usage. For basic browsing and email, 25 Mbps might be sufficient. For streaming video, 50-100 Mbps is recommended. For gaming and video conferencing, 100 Mbps or higher is ideal. If you have multiple devices connected simultaneously, you'll need a faster speed.

4. What is a good internet speed for working from home in Crawley, Virginias?
For working from home, a download speed of at least 50 Mbps and an upload speed of at least 10 Mbps is recommended. This will allow you to participate in video conferences, download and upload files, and browse the internet without significant lag or interruption. If you frequently use large files or collaborate with others online, a faster speed is advisable.

Tips for Choosing an Internet Provider in Crawley, Virginias
Check Availability: Not all providers are available in all areas of Crawley, Virginias. Use the provider's website or call them to confirm availability at your specific address.
Read Reviews: Check online reviews to get an idea of the provider's customer service and reliability.
Understand Data Caps: Be aware of any data caps that may apply to your chosen plan. Exceeding your data cap can result in overage charges or slower speeds.
Negotiate: Don't be afraid to negotiate the price with the provider. They may be willing to offer a better deal to win your business.
Consider Bundling: If you also need TV or phone service, consider bundling your services to save money.
